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40328178196 1354168 654
777533 00112612 19
777533 00112612 19
027435460 79538184149 18256642181
All about undefined
Interested in learning more?
777533 00112612 19
027435460 79538184149 18256642181
See more
1310010 35958432 31112522
36826 1696642 13664
See more
1461573841 23263106
570230 872828857 851042 19
See more